Candy Club is a candy subscription that sends 2-3 pounds of premier, brand name candy directly to your door each month.
In summer, Candy Club adds insulated packaging to help protect their candy from the heat.
My Subscription Addiction pays for this subscription. (Check out the review process post to learn more about how we review boxes.)
The Subscription Box: Candy Club
The Cost: $27.99 + $6 shipping per month ($19.99 + $6 shipping per month with a year subscription)
The Products: Up to 3 pounds of candy (from classics to contemporary favorites) packed into 3 of Candy Club’s signature containers.
Ships to: US
Each Candy Club Box comes with a card detailing the month’s featured candies.
On the reverse, nutritional details are listed along with any relevant allergy information.

Vidal has been making candy since 1963, and Candy Club imports their products directly from their Spanish factory. These gummy cola bottles are larger and softer than the ones I usually buy from Haribo, and I like them a lot.
In February, I received Allan Sour Cherry Slices in my Candy Club box, and, unsurprisingly, these are similar. I really like the sour cherry flavor, and I think I actually prefer these minis to the full-sized version.
Primrose Wild Berry Hard Candies
Primrose Wild Berry Hard Candies come in a variety of flavors. They’re sweet (not sour at all), and I like the different berry flavors. I don’t usually buy hard candy, but I’ve found that I enjoy receiving it in my Candy Club Boxes.
Zotz are hard candies filled with fizzy powder. They come in cherry, apple, grape, blue raspberry, watermelon, and orange. I like the variety of flavors- I think apple might be my favorite!
Verdict: I look forward to receiving a box from Candy Club every month. They always send a fresh and fun selection of sweet treats, and I generally like the candies they feature. This month, I loved the Zotz, Sour Cherry Slices, and Cola Bottles. In terms of value, Candy Club claims that each box will have a retail value of $60. I struggle a little bit with that because, while similar pricing is typical at high-end candy stores like Dylan’s Candy Bar, you can definitely purchase the same candy for a lot less if you buy it in bulk online. Still, I think Candy Club’s packaging and candy selection add a lot of value, and I like getting a giant box of candy delivered to my doorstep.
